    Eduardo Recife is an illustrator/designer/typographer from Brazil. His personal website "Misprinted Type" has been online since 1998, and won recognition in several books and magazines around the world. He has created 23 typefaces over the years; done work for clients such as The New York Times, HBO, Burton, Nike; and exhibited his artworks in the US, Belgium, Brazil, Lithuania and Mexico.  

    Recife`s work is full of dualities. Joyful vintage imagery is often put together in empty, sad compositions. Unconfortable criticism of outrageous human conditions are made in a somehow peaceful, reflection inviting way. Antique symbols of art refinement are transformed to serve bold contemporary messages. Visual rejects of a sterile society, such as the texture of time taking over the material world are all combined in a harmonic and beautiful way. Computer technology, usually perceived as cold and virtual, comes in to perpetrate and homage some of the most tangible art forms.
